Founded in 2023, Active Surfaces is a private headquartered in Woburn, United States with approximately 50-200 employees specializing in Solar.
Active Surfaces leverages decade-long MIT research to commercialize perovskite solar technology. The company produces flexible, ultra-lightweight solar cells using commodity materials and low-temperature manufacturing processes. Key advantages include 10x lighter weight than traditional silicon panels, 90% lower labor costs, superior low-light performance, and suitability for distributed manufacturing. The technology addresses supply chain concentration in China and enables solar deployment on structures unable to support conventional panels, such as warehouses and lightweight roofs. The company is backed by a team of MIT-trained scientists and engineers with expertise in perovskite materials, roll-to-roll manufacturing, and climate tech commercialization.
